EBay can I accept bid before end of auction?
Sorry can't find answer on eBay Help but am sure someone here knows the answer. Am trying to sell my Stag and there are still 8 days left to run. Can I accept a satisfactory bid - there's a reserve on it of course - and cancel the auction before it runs out? (Yes I want the readies in my hand).

In motors you can end early to sell to the highest bidder.
It's pretty easy http://offer.ebay.co.uk/ws/eBayISAPI...ndingMyAuction Select sell to current high bidder. If they havent bid, change the reserve to the agreed price, tell them to bid, then end it https://www.ebay.co.uk/help/selling/...isting?id=4356 |
